The Growing Importance of Real-Time Feedback in UX Research

Traditional UX research involved retrospective surveys and usability tests, which, while valuable, often missed the nuanced, moment-to-moment reactions users have when interacting with a product. Real-time feedback allows researchers to capture authentic emotional responses, frustrations, and delight that might be forgotten or misremembered later.

By gathering data instantly, psychologists can:

  • Understand the immediate impact of design changes.
  • Pinpoint pain points in the user journey as they happen.
  • Adjust product features dynamically based on user sentiment.

2. Behavioral Analytics Platforms

Psychologists leverage platforms that track detailed user interactions — clicks, scrolls, hovers, and even gaze paths — to quantify engagement levels and identify UX issues. Heatmaps, session recordings, and funnel analysis are common features offered by these platforms.

3. Emotion Recognition and Biometrics

Advanced research incorporates emotion detection through facial coding, voice analysis, and physiological monitoring (heart rate, skin conductance). These tools offer a biometric layer to traditional feedback, revealing subconscious reactions beyond self-reports.

4. A/B Testing with Psychological Insights

Combining split-testing tools with psychological frameworks such as cognitive load theory or motivation models helps researchers experiment with different designs and content. This experimental approach identifies which variations optimize user satisfaction and behavior.

5. Natural Language Processing (NLP) for Sentiment Analysis

AI-powered sentiment analysis parses open-ended feedback, reviews, and social media chatter to gauge public perception of a product or feature. Psychologists use this to complement quantitative data with qualitative insights.
